Well it's about the game's pointer! It's flickering left and right, and I had to use some extra parameter in order to get it work.

From the game's Readme:
Quote

 P96WritePixelArray
  ------------------
  If the pointer flickers, or you have other problems with the screen update, and are
  running P96, you may have succes with the "P96WritePixelArray" argument, which uses
  that method when writing to the screen instead of writing directly. CGX doesn't
  have such a method for 16 bit buffers. Note that this method is much slower than
  our custom routines, especially on a PPC.


I did it and worked fine for the 640x480, but on the 800x600 still flickers! What's wrong?

640x480 startup:
Quote

stack 65536
earth2140.WOS.exe P96WritePixelArray


800x600 startup:
Quote

stack 65536
earth2140.wos.exe x800 P96WritePixelArray


Another question about WinUAE: is it possible to have a big endian screen mode (P96)? I tried to run it on the emulator (68K executable, naturally) but complains that there isn't any big endian mode (that's true for the PC hardware, but isn't there any double screen-mode such in AMiGA, or any kind of hack for the UAE monitor definitions?)
